Q: Is 10,606,004 a Prime Number?
A: No, 10,606,004 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 10606004 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 2,651,501 5,303,002 and 10,606,004, with no remainder.
Since 10,606,004 cannot be divided by just 1 and 10,606,004, it is not a prime number.
